Transaction f89cea1cf12f730d098b7c7b31fc11b22a4200455701a4e3d96d2a20b71ee600

block
c30d651fcdc1ee8c37a4c7da1b6b7329fbc53e9c65854e90236bdb58a329cb66

1 Input

529 Outputs